Summary
On 5 May 1974 at about 12:30 local time, a Raven S50A registered N73RD was involved in an accident during the landing phase of flight near Lafayette, New York, United States. 2 people were on board and one was seriously injured, one had minor injuries. The aircraft was not dam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ative
AT 100FT, LNDG APPROACH, HOT AIR BALLOON ENCTRD TURBC.DUE SPIN ATTITUDE, PLT UN GET HEAT INTO BALLOON
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
